LOLLAPOCALYPSE NOW: This weekend’s massive three-day Lollapalooza festival in Chicago’s Grant Park was marred by a huge storm which forced the evacuation of 60,000 fans from the venue on Saturday before resuming later that day. Several bands, including Alabama Shakes, Temper Trap, the Dunwells, B.o.B and Paper Diamond, were forced to postpone their sets, but the show went on, with headlining performances by Red Hot Chili Peppers and Frank Ocean, among others, over the weekend. Other highlights of the three-day fest included performances by Jack White, At the Drive In, tUnE-yArDs, The Weeknd and the Dum Dum Girls.
